MWC 2012: 1 Million Windows 8 Consumer Preview Downloads Milestone Hit in One Day
Microsoft demoed Windows 8 at this year’s MWC edition in Barcelona, Spain, and released the Windows 8 Consumer Preview so the crowds can finally enjoy the new desktop and tablet operating system. And the response from the Windows-loving crowd has been overwhelming so far.

Google’s New Privacy Policy Breaches EU Law According to Commissioner
Google’s proposed privacy policy changes, meant to merge over 60 distinct privacy policies for various Google services into a single one, entered effect today, but regulators are still not happy with Google’s approach on this matter.

OnLive Desktop App Now Available For Android
The OnLive Desktop app launched for the iPad back in January and as of today it looks like Android users will have the same. Yup, the OnLive Desktop app has recently made an appearance in the Android Market.
